Dumpster Dimension Choice



When picking a dumpster size, take into consideration the quantity of waste you require to get rid of and the area readily available on your home. It's important to accurately approximate the quantity of particles you'll be disposing of to guarantee you pick a dumpster that can fit all of it. If you opt for a dimension that's as well small, you might end up requiring several trips to the land fill or extra pick-ups, causing added costs and inconvenience.

To determine the appropriate dimension, take stock of the type and amount of materials you'll be throwing away. For little cleanouts or remodellings, a 10-yard dumpster might suffice. For larger tasks like whole-home cleanouts or construction, you might require a 20 or 30-yard dumpster. By evaluating your waste quantity and offered area, you can select the appropriate dumpster size to successfully manage your cleanup requirements.

Resident Regulations Recognition



To make sure a smooth dumpster rental experience, it's vital to understand regional guidelines regulating garbage disposal in your location. Different cities and areas have certain rules pertaining to where and exactly how dumpsters can be put, what materials are enabled to be taken care of, and the necessary permits for positioning a dumpster on your residential property or the street. Failing to abide by these regulations can cause fines or other penalties, so it's critical to acquaint yourself with the regional demands prior to scheduling a dumpster.



Some areas may have limitations on the kinds of materials that can be thrown away in a dumpster, such as hazardous waste or electronic devices. Additionally, there may be guidelines on the positioning of the dumpster, such as range from property lines or ensuring it does not obstruct traffic or access to emergency services. Garbage Disposal Guidelines



Prior to you start disposing of waste in the leased dumpster, it's crucial to stick to certain guidelines to make sure correct and efficient disposal.

Initially, segregate your waste into groups such as recyclables, natural waste, and basic garbage. This will make disposal easier and much more environmentally friendly.

Be mindful of any type of hazardous materials that are restricted from being unloaded in the dumpster, such as chemicals, batteries, or electronics. These items call for unique disposal approaches to prevent damage to the setting and public health.

Additionally, avoid overfilling the dumpster beyond its capability limit, as this can pose safety and security dangers during transport.

Understand the weight limits established by the rental firm and stay clear of exceeding them to avoid extra fees or difficulties.
